In the heart of Basilicata, in Viggianello, Rappasciona Fest celebrates one of the most authentic recipes of Lucanian peasant tradition. Rappasciona is far more than a simple soup: it is a humble dish that embodies the gastronomic wisdom of generations, prepared with genuine ingredients such as beans, corn, wheat, and the extraordinary touch of saffron. This blend of simple yet powerful flavors represents the essence of mountain cuisine, where necessity transforms into culinary creativity. The festival turns the village streets into an immersive experience where gastronomy becomes a vehicle for cultural identity. Food stalls offer the traditional soup alongside other typical Lucanian dishes, accompanied by local wines and sweets that complete an authentic food and wine journey. It is not just food, but a story of a territory and its people. Folk music, performances, and artisan markets animate the atmosphere, creating an event that unites community and visitors around the values of conviviality and tradition. Rappasciona Fest is the perfect opportunity to discover how Lucanian popular cuisine transforms humility and simple ingredients into an unforgettable collective experience.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is rappasciona?expand_more
Rappasciona is a rustic traditional soup from Lucanian peasant cuisine, prepared with beans, corn, wheat, and saffron. It is a humble dish rich in authentic flavors, a symbol of mountain cuisine in Basilicata.
What dishes can you taste during the festival?expand_more
Beyond rappasciona, the gastronomic stalls offer other typical Lucanian dishes, accompanied by local wines and traditional desserts, for a complete food and wine experience of the territory.
What activities are planned besides gastronomy?expand_more
The event features live folk music, folkloric performances, and artisan markets that animate the village streets, creating a festive and convivial atmosphere.
